NATO tests new drone technologies after Russian incursions
At Portuguese and Dutch bases, NATO forces are conducting simultaneous tests of new aerial and underwater drones. With numerous Russian incursions into European airspace in recent weeks, the Atlantic alliance aims to prepare a technological response, helped by Ukrainian special forces.
